      Daily Crime In Rockledge (per 100,000 people)

      The graph above looks at the comparison of crimes committed in Rockledge on a daily basis (per 100,000 people) to crimes committed throughout the state of Florida and the USA. According to the latest crime statistics, daily crimes in Rockledge (which include property crimes as well as violent crimes), when compared to Florida, are 1.53 times less than the state average and 1.67 times less than than national average. Violent crimes committed in Rockledge on a daily basis are 1.83 times less than than Florida average and 1.85 times less than the average nationwide. Daily property crime rates in Rockledge are 1.48 times less than the daily state average and 1.63 times less than the daily national numbers.

      Chance of Being A Victim of Crime in Rockledge

      The chance of being a victim of violent crime in Rockledge is 1 in 477
      The chance of being a victim of property crime in Rockledge is 1 in 84
      The chance of being a victim of crime in Rockledge is 1 in 72
      Wondering what the chances are that you fall victim to a crime in Rockledge? In Rockledge, FL you have a 1 in 477 chance of becoming a victim of violent crime. Violent crimes include murder, rape, robbery and assault. With regards to property crime, you have a 1 in 84 chance of becoming a victim. Property crimes include burglary, theft and motor vehicle theft. Overall, you have a 1 in 72 chance of becoming a victim of crime in Rockledge.

      Year Over Year Crime In Rockledge (per 100,000 people)

      Determining whether Rockledge is becoming less or more safe for its residents (per 100,000) is most easily done by comparing year-over-year crime rates. Rockledge violent crime rates have decreased by 5%. At the same time, property crime has decreased by 13% year over year. Total crimes for Rockledge has decreased by 12% in the same time frame.

      Rockledge police department

      ItemRockledgeFloridaNational
      Law enforcement employees (officers & civilians)6731,023558,732
      Police officers & civilians /1000 residents2.74.23.3
      There are a total of 67 Rockledge police officers. This results in 2.7 police officers per 1,000 residents which is 37.4% less than the Florida average and 18.5% less than the National average.

      Source: The Rockledge, FL crime data displayed above is derived from the FBI's uniform crime reports for the year of 2020. The crime report encompasses more than 18,000 city and state law enforcement agencies reporting data on property and violent crimes. The uniform crime reports program represents approximately 309 million American residents, which results in 98% coverage of metropolitan statistical areas.
